EXCEEDS logo
Exceeds
huangfan

PROFILE

Huangfan

Over a two-month period, this developer enhanced the iflytek/astron-agent repository by delivering robust backend features and improving deployment reliability. They stabilized the RAGFlow client, refining error handling, configuration management, and session logic using Python and asynchronous programming. Their work enabled dual-mode document ingestion, supporting both URL-based and file uploads with thorough parameter validation and form-data parsing. To address concurrency issues, they introduced a module-level asynchronous lock, preventing race conditions during dataset creation. Additionally, they consolidated deployment and environment documentation, streamlining onboarding and reducing setup errors. Their contributions improved CI compliance, code maintainability, and overall development velocity.

Overall Statistics

Feature vs Bugs

75%Features

Repository Contributions

14Total
Bugs
1
Commits
14
Features
3
Lines of code
5,596
Activity Months2

Work History

October 2025

9 Commits • 1 Features

Oct 1, 2025

October 2025 focused on strengthening deployment reliability, onboarding efficiency, and data integrity for the astron-agent project. Delivered extensive deployment and configuration documentation improvements, consolidated configuration references, and refined environment variable guidance to reduce setup errors. Implemented a robust concurrency fix to prevent race conditions during dataset creation by introducing a module-level asynchronous lock. These efforts improved deployment accuracy, reduced onboarding time, and increased production stability, directly supporting faster time-to-value for customers and smoother CI/CD workflows.

September 2025

5 Commits • 2 Features

Sep 1, 2025

Monthly work summary for 2025-09 focusing on the iflytek/astron-agent repo. Highlights include major feature delivery, bug fixes, and improvements to reliability, testing, and data ingestion workflows.

Activity

Loading activity data...

Quality Metrics

Correctness97.2%
Maintainability96.4%
Architecture93.6%
Performance92.8%
AI Usage20.0%

Skills & Technologies

Programming Languages

MarkdownPython

Technical Skills

API IntegrationAsynchronous ProgrammingBackend DevelopmentCode RefactoringConcurrency ControlConfiguration ManagementData ProcessingDocumentationError HandlingFile HandlingInternationalizationMockingPythonRefactoringTechnical Writing

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

iflytek/astron-agent

Sep 2025 Oct 2025
2 Months active

Languages Used

PythonMarkdown

Technical Skills

API IntegrationBackend DevelopmentCode RefactoringConfiguration ManagementData ProcessingError Handling

Generated by Exceeds AIThis report is designed for sharing and indexing